Who they’re for: Latinx people working in tech or pursuing technical careers, as well as allies who support the Latinx community

What they do: Latinas in Tech hosts virtual and in-person networking events and a popular annual summit with a competition that awards Latina-founded tech startups. Studies have shown that when Latinx entrepreneurs start a business, 70% of their funding comes from personal savings because they often lack the resources and the network to access capital. Latinas in Tech aims to change that: “Latina entrepreneurs are not only capable of working in the tech industry, they are innovators that have proven themselves to be creators of tech as well,” Rocio van Nierop, CEO of Latinas in Tech, said in a release.

Latinas in Tech also has a members-only job board that’s focused on full-time tech roles in an effort to diversify the tech talent pipeline. The nonprofit organization covers various roles within the tech ecosystem, including Engineers, Cybersecurity Experts, Data Scientists, and more.

How you can get involved: There are local Latinas in Tech chapters that you can join around the world to meet other Latinx tech professionals. Regardless of your career level, you can volunteer to mentor another Latinas in Tech member and provide professional and leadership development tools.

Who they’re for: Girls and non-binary students in elementary and middle school all the way through college

What they do: Girls Who Code offers a range of courses, from after-school and summer clubs to college programs, that teach participants core computer science and programming skills. They also provide workshops where students can build websites and applications that help address issues in their communities, like climate change and cyberbullying. Reshma Saujani founded Girls Who Code in 2012 to help nurture the next generation of leaders:

“Young girls are change agents,” she tells “The Daily Show.” “When they have technology, they’re looking at their community, they’re looking at the world, and they’re saying, ‘How can I use technology to make it better?’”

How you can get involved: Want to sign up for a Girls Who Code program? Click here to find the right one for you. Or, if you’d prefer to help support Girls Who Code, you can start an after-school club, form a corporate partnership, fundraise, and/or campaign. Who they’re for: Youth and adults of marginalized genders, including non-binary, gender nonconforming, and female-identifying, with an emphasis on racial and ethnic minorities, LGBTQIA+ people, and those from low-income communities

What they do: ChickTech provides learning opportunities and technical education in 15 countries around the world.

Their high school and college programs offer skill-building workshops and help connect participants to professional networks with formal and informal mentorships. Plus, their signature adult program, Advancing the Careers of Technical Women (ACT-W), helps professionals develop their technical and leadership skills with career coaching and national conferences.

Janice Levenhagen-Seely, founder and former CEO of ChickTeck, explains how she formed the organization to help welcome girls and women into the tech industry:

“I started ChickTech to give girls and women the support and sense of belonging that I didn’t have when I was a Computer Engineer. We focus on high school girls because so many of them are still not encouraged to be engineers and programmers, and they rarely even know what a career in tech would look like.”

How you can get involved: If you’re a high school student looking to break into tech (or want to nominate someone who is), click here to register for their virtual high school program. Or if you’re further along in your career and want to use your expertise to mentor students, reach out to your local ChickTech community and inquire about leading a workshop. You can also speak at one of their ACT-W events or even become a member of ACT-W+.

Who they’re for: Women and gender-expansive adults, particularly racial and ethnic minorities, LGBTQIA+ people, and those from low-income communities

What they do: Named after famed programmer Ada Lovelace, ADA offers a unique, immersive experience for women looking to break into tech. Their free, 6-month training program teaches participants the core skills they’ll need to launch careers in software development, like the fundamentals of computer science and programming with languages including Python, JavaScript, and SQL.

“We aim to reduce the economic barriers to a career in software development by making education and career preparation as accessible as possible,” explains Elise Worthy, co-founder of ADA. “Because many of our students are switching careers and already carrying student loan debt, it would be untenable to expect them to assume an even greater financial burden while taking a year off from earning a full-time salary to pursue a whole new career.”

How you can get involved: ADA asks that aspiring students complete their preparatory curriculum before applying to their program. You can also volunteer with ADA to help promote the growth of new technologists as a private tutor, teaching assistant, industry mentor, mock interviewer, or admissions volunteer.

Here are the broad stages of any job search:

1. Clarify your career goals. You may remember this from our resume series—the same rationale applies here. Knowing what you want to do, where you want to be, and why can make it easier to focus your job search efforts.

2. Identify your key job skills. Based on your career goals, check out open roles on LinkedIn and grow your network to learn about opportunities available to you. Get a feel for the companies that are hiring and the skills you’ll need to land a position.

3. Write your resume. Think of this document as your first introduction to potential employers. If you want more guidance on formatting and what to include, revisit our resume series for a section-by-section breakdown, learn how to use ChatGPT to write your resume, or check out SUNY Online’s 5-hour course, How to Write a Resume.

4. Apply for jobs. Job listings will typically outline everything you need to submit in order to be considered for a role. Be sure to follow instructions exactly as stated. You can typically expect to fill out online forms, upload your resume, write a cover letter, and submit work samples, depending on your desired role. If you are able to apply directly with the recruiter or hiring manager, take a look at our tips for writing a stand-out job application email.

5. Ace your interviews. Interviews are your opportunity to find out more about a position and show off what you can do. We’ll offer more concrete interview tips in an upcoming series, but for now, check out our best interview tips.

6. Follow up. It’s a good habit to send recruiters and hiring managers a follow-up email after an interview. At the very least, you can thank them for their time—but for roles you’re really excited about, it’s an opportunity to reiterate your enthusiasm and gather more details to make your decision.

7. Refine your process. A job search can take time, so it’s important to keep building skills, updating your resume, and reflecting on your goals. Set up job alerts to stay up-to-date on new job listings. Take time to consider and incorporate feedback you receive from recruiters. If you’re feeling stuck, here are some ways you can expand your job search, be that online, through networking, continuing career prep, or seeking a counselor.

If you’re feeling stalled on any one of these steps, it may help to examine the step directly before it in addition to the step you’re stuck on. For example, if you’re applying for jobs and not getting any interviews, take a closer look at your resume and make sure it’s optimized for the positions you’re applying for; or if you’re uninspired throughout the interview process, consider whether the jobs you’re applying for really align with the job you want.

What does a Cloud Engineer do? 

A Cloud Engineer is a Software Engineer that focuses on migrating data from local servers to cloud-based services. Once those systems are up and running, Cloud Engineers keep them maintained and updated. Cloud Engineers often write front-end or back-end code, but they also need to be familiar with cloud computing tools and concepts like: 

  • How to structure a cloud-based application for performance and security  
  • The best practices for engineering in the cloud  
  • A strong understanding of AWS, GCP, and/or Azure

Top programming languages for Cloud Engineers 

Some languages are more popular than others for creating applications that run in the cloud, and learning one or more of those languages will give you an advantage in landing a job as a Cloud Engineer. Here are the best languages for cloud development: 

Python 

Python is one of the most popular and widely used programming languages today, so it makes sense that it’s one of the top languages Cloud Engineers use. Google also offers Python-based tools for Google Cloud, so it’s a great choice for cloud development. 

Python’s extensive libraries and cross-platform support make it easier to write software for and manage all the diverse parts of a cloud environment’s development life cycle. Python is also a multi-paradigm language that can be used to write in a procedural, functional, or object-oriented programming style, giving it a lot of flexibility.

Go 

Golang, or Go, is programming language developed by Google and is the newest programming language in this list. Despite its relative newness, its capacity for speed and performance, along with its standardized APIs, make Go great for cloud development

Golang is a low-level language, like C or C++, but it has high-level features that make it easier to use and less verbose than other low-level programming languages. It supports concurrency, package management, parallelism, and garbage collection. And because it’s low-level, it’s also faster and has much smaller executables than other languages on this list. 

Ruby 

Ruby is a popular beginner-friendly programming language that’s secure and supports many features. It’s so popular that there are over 60,000 frameworks and libraries in the language, so creating an app with Ruby is a straightforward process. Compared to many other languages on this list, you can deploy an application to the cloud with a lot less code using Ruby. 

Java 

As Java users say, “Java is everywhere” — and that includes the cloud (as you can see in Microsoft’s Azure). Java is a general-purpose, object-oriented language that you can use for many programming tasks. 

Java is also a highly portable language, meaning that you can take the Java code compiled on one system and run it on another, as long as you have the Java Virtual Machine installed on the other machine. This makes it an extremely useful language in a distributed, cloud-based environment. 

C# 

C# is a popular language in the Microsoft ecosystem. It’s the most popular language used in Microsoft’s ASP.NET framework. ASP.NET is used to create dynamic, robust web apps that run on Windows Server. 

Recently, C# has become a cross-platform language that can also run on Linux and Mac OS using the .NET Core framework. This change has made it even more popular for cloud development, especially on Linux. 

Node.js and JavaScript 

Node.js, first released in 2009, implements server-side services using JavaScript. It quickly became popular because it allowed front-end developers that traditionally used JavaScript to write back-end code without having to learn a new language — which means front-end developers can use Node.js to create complete cloud applications.

In “The Mind-Boggling Simplicity of Learning to Say ‘No,’” the writer Leslie Jamison reflects on her struggle to turn people down:

When I was 25, I took a job at a bakery in a small college town in the Midwest. I worked front and back of house, pulling espresso shots at the bar and running into the kitchen to grab my (often burned) sugar cookies from the oven.

My boss and I had agreed on a weekly schedule — I wanted desperately to be a writer and was trying to carve out time to work on my novel — but it seemed like she was always asking me to take on another shift, or stay late, or come in early, and I found it difficult to refuse. If I said no, I worried that I would be leaving her in a jam, or that she might decide I wasn’t worth keeping on the staff at all. (My skills in the kitchen hardly justified my presence.)

One afternoon I was venting about it to my stepfather, expecting his sympathy, and he just shook his head, vaguely amused. Then he offered one of the best pieces of wisdom I’ve ever received: “She has the right to ask the question, and you have the right to say no.”

This was mind-boggling in both its simplicity and its radical reframing. The requests that I’d experienced as acts of violation were really nothing of the sort; it was not only my right but also my responsibility to draw my own boundaries, rather than expect another person to draw them for me.

Ms. Jamison goes on to describe how keeping a “Notebook of Noes” helped her think about her refusals differently:

On every page, I wrote down an opportunity I had decided to decline: a speaking gig, a magazine commission, an invitation from a friend. Then I drew a line across the page. Underneath, I wrote what saying no had made room for: more time with my partner. More time at home. More time to write. More time to call my mother and ask about her day, and tell her about mine.

Because I was a writer, it helped me to list my own refusals in a notebook. It was as if, in their accumulation, they could create a meaningful text: the story of learning to live a different way.

As I gathered more of these noes, I learned that, even after I’d uttered the word, the world continued just as it always had. The people I’d been anxious about disappointing? They were OK. The fear of losing something for good? It often came back, or something else did.

More than anything, however, the Notebook of Noes helped me see absence as a form of presence — instead of lamenting the ghost limb of what I wasn’t doing, I could acknowledge that every refusal was making it more possible to do something else.

This is a fascinating true story about Elizebeth Smith, a woman who went from studying languages and Shakespeare to becoming America’s first female cryptanalyst. Elizabeth was highly skilled in “code-breaking,” which is a process of decrypting code or cipher messages to uncover hidden information. She worked as a cryptanalyst during both World Wars, and went on to work for the U.S. Navy, Treasury, Coast Guard, and Army. Buy it here.

Why I chose to learn to code

“Before my first job in tech, I was working as a Medical Doctor. In my second year of med school, I had a professor who was working as a researcher, and he used tools like Rstudio on Python. He showed us the tip of the iceberg of what Python can do. I found Codecademy for first time, because I was looking all over the internet for resources to learn Python 2 for free. It was kind of a hobby, and it was always there. But I didn’t imagine myself working as a Software Engineer until Covid.

Here in Latin America, being a doctor is really tough; you don’t have the support from the government or the healthcare companies. I have three kids, and with the Covid pandemic, we were working like 90 hours per week. It was insane.

Learn something new for free

I saw a quote that said, ‘You have to fight to spend more time with your family than with your boss,’ which felt like a knife to my heart. I thought, I have to switch careers and move on and do something else. I was looking for a job that I really like, and I can do from home.”

How I made time to learn

“I wake up at almost five in the morning, do two to three hours, then go to the hospital. I work in the hospital. Sometimes I have free time in the shift of the ambulance. I’d read short articles or whatever I can finish in a few minutes. After work, I would try to continue to study, and my wife was a huge support for that.”

How long it took me to land a job

“In February 2021, I got a job at a telecommunication company. All of my friends told me that the biggest achievement is getting your first job — after that, it’s always easier. Being outside the IT world, I didn’t believe that. I was on LinkedIn looking for all the junior job vacancies. If the job description said I had to learn Swift to code the iOS application, I started to learn Swift. I did the same with JavaScript, HTML, CSS, and whatever I needed to get my first job.”

How I got in the door

“One of my friends is a Software Engineering Manager at Amazon and had some connections here in in Argentina. He told me that there was a job search for a Data Engineer at this telecommunication company, and he pointed me out to one of the heads of the data analytics teams. I added him on LinkedIn, and we started talking. It was difficult because the job description was like, this unicorn person who must know everything about everything. And I thought, I can’t do this job.

When the head of the company interviewed me, he told me that this was for a semi-senior role. I was in my first job as a new Data Engineer, and I lacked [work experience]. At that time, I had knowledge about Git and GitHub, but on the theoretical side of things — not in practice. I was super afraid of that because there was a three-month trial period for this semi-senior role, and I have all my family on my back. I was like, Should I do it or not?

How I nailed the interview

“It’s all about attitude, like showing yourself with your weakness and saying, ‘I don’t know, but I can learn.’ You have to show that you could learn almost anything if you needed and that you are motivated. I sold myself in that interview so much. I thought, This guy has to hire me, there’s no other option.”

How I evaluated the offer

“At this moment, I’m pretty comfortable with my company. The salaries are not even near what you can make in the US, but the career path they have is really good. I have impostor syndrome like everyone, and I have a lot of knowledge gaps that I need to solve. So now I’m pursuing that knowledge, not the high-paying job. Perhaps in five years, I will look for something that meets the adrenaline that I need for my personality and provides new challenges.”

How day one and beyond went

“I had the study mentality from med school, so I would wake up two hours early for work and read all the things I had in my notebook. I’d write down a lot of terms that I didn’t understand to look up later. Everyone was talking about the ‘data lake’ that it was ‘on-prem’ and ‘cloud’ — I was like, what does that mean?

The first month was difficult, because you have to pick up the language, learn how they write code, and read documentation. One of the best things that I learned was to read the documentation and code. Sometimes we really hate documenting our code, but it’s super useful to know how to do it and try to use the rubber duck to talk about what your code is doing.”
